About this route:
A direct, nonstop flight between Cootamundra Airport (CMD), Cootamundra, New South Wales, Australia and Alghero-Fertilia Airport (AHO), Alghero, Sardinia, Italy would travel a Great Circle distance of 10,215 miles (or 16,440 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Cootamundra Airport and Alghero-Fertilia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Alghero-Fertilia Airport (AHO):
- The closest airport to Alghero-Fertilia Airport (AHO) is Olbia Costa Smeralda Airport (OLB), which is located 67 miles (107 kilometers) ENE of AHO.
- The furthest airport from Alghero-Fertilia Airport (AHO) is Chatham Islands (CHT), which is nearly antipodal to Alghero-Fertilia Airport (meaning Alghero-Fertilia Airport is almost on the exact opposite side of the Earth from Chatham Islands), and is located 12,109 miles (19,488 kilometers) away in Waitangi, Chatham Islands, New Zealand.
- On 23 November 2007 management of the airport was transferred to SO.GE.A.AL.
- In addition to being known as "Alghero-Fertilia Airport", another name for AHO is "Aeroporto di Alghero-Fertilia".
- Alghero-Fertilia Airport (AHO) currently has only 1 runway.
- The airport opened in March 1938 as a military airport.
- Alghero-Fertilia Airport handled 1,518,870 passengers last year.
- Because of Alghero-Fertilia Airport's relatively low elevation of 87 feet, planes can take off or land at Alghero-Fertilia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
